Baglioni Hotels mourns the sudden passing on Christmas Day of a dear friend and colleague, group vice-president and general manager Maurizio d’Este. Mr d’Este, a legendary travel professional was the epitome of Venetian elegance and graciousness, and served in many roles over a long career. He was GM at the Baglioni Luna in Venezia and […]

Dolce & Gabbana and Smeg have teamed up to create a range of colourful kitchen appliances, inspired by Sicilian art. The collection has been dubbed Sicily Is My Love.    The designs are not unlike those on pottery and artworks from the island, and adorn the toaster, citrus press, blender and kettle.    The kettle’s […]

Canadian singer–songwriter Shawn Mendes fronts Emporio Armani Connected’s autumn–winter 2018–19 smartwatch campaign. The new watches are now available for ordering (pre-sale) online at armani.com, and hit shelves in early September, at both Armani stores and selected retailers.    The latest touchscreen smartwatches have a Qualcomm Snapdragon Wear 2100 SoC processor running Google’s Wear OS, and […]
